Overview of Inspection Tools

Automobile inspection tool is a specialized inspection equipment used to measure and evaluate the dimensional quality of parts.
At the production site of the parts, online inspection of the parts is completed through automotive inspection tools. To achieve this, the parts need to be accurately installed on the inspection tools, and then visually inspected, or measured with a gauge or caliper, to check the surface and surroundings of the parts. It is also possible to visually inspect the holes of different properties on the parts and the connection orientation between parts by inspection pins or visual inspection, and then ensure the rapid determination of the quality status of the parts during production. In this case, it can be determined through visual inspection or measurement that there is an error between the size and shape area around the contour of the part, as well as the relative orientation, and the theoretical value of the gauge directly processed by CAD/CAM.
Regarding certain extremely important functional dimensions on the parts, numerical testing can also be performed using gauges. Usually, it is not possible to directly obtain accurate coordinate values of parts based on the vehicle coordinate system using a measuring tool. Instead, the parts are placed on the measuring tool and measured by a three coordinate measuring machine before being obtained. The structure of modern gauges is designed with consideration for their ability to serve as measuring brackets. But when the online inspection function of the measuring tool and the measurement bracket function cannot be satisfied at the same time, the online inspection function of the measuring tool should be satisfied first.
The measuring bracket is an auxiliary bracket used when measuring parts with a three coordinate measuring machine. All its supporting surfaces (points) and positioning reference surfaces (points) need to be milled according to the CAD data of the parts. Some special parts' measuring brackets should also have the function of partial gauges.
Automotive inspection tools are specialized inspection equipment customized according to the requirements of the demand side. The design of the inspection tools must be based on the final 3D data and 2D drawings provided by the customer. The 3D data must have the correct automotive coordinate system, and the design and production of the inspection tools must be approved by the customer before processing and delivery.
